Welding Cable Ampacity Chart

Welding Cable Ampacity Chart - The sizes of cables generally used ranged from 2 awg to 3/0 awg. Cable length, wire size (gauge), resistance rating; The ampacity, or amperage capacity, is the maximum amount of electrical current that the welding cable can conduct safely.
